West Beach Campground Introduce

For those in search of a genuine "camping near me" experience that offers both serene beauty and ample outdoor activities, West Beach Campground at Yuba State Park in Levan, UT, stands out as a compelling choice. Located at Levan, UT 84639, USA, and accessible via phone at (435) 758-2611 or +1 435-758-2611, West Beach Campground is a distinct area within the larger Yuba State Park, renowned for its warm waters and diverse recreational offerings.

West Beach Campground is characterized by its primitive camping style, set along the gravel and sandy beaches of Yuba Lake. Unlike some more developed campgrounds, West Beach does not have designated individual sites with specific hookups. Instead, it offers a "choose your own camping location along an open beach" experience, providing a sense of freedom and open space that many campers cherish. This characteristic contributes to the feeling of getting "away from it all," as highlighted by positive customer reviews emphasizing the "beauty and tranquility" of the location. This type of environment is particularly appealing to campers seeking a more unconfined and natural setting, where the focus is on the expansive views and the direct access to the lake.

The environment at West Beach Campground is defined by its lakeside setting, offering stunning views of Yuba Lake. This is a significant draw for visitors, providing picturesque sunrises and sunsets over the water. The surrounding landscape features sagebrush, sandy rock, and layers of red shale, creating a unique desert-meets-water panorama. While primitive, the campground is equipped with essential facilities to ensure a comfortable stay. These typically include vault toilets and garbage collection points, and picnic tables and metal fire rings are usually provided, enhancing the traditional camping experience of cooking over an open flame and gathering outdoors. Given its primitive nature, campers should be prepared for a less manicured environment compared to more developed campgrounds like Oasis within Yuba State Park.

A key feature of West Beach is its direct beach access, which is perfect for water-based activities. Yuba Lake is known for its warm water temperatures, making it ideal for swimming, boating, canoeing, and kayaking. For anglers, the lake offers opportunities for fishing, with walleye, trout, and yellow perch being common catches. The primitive beach camping allows campers to set up close to the water, providing convenient access for launching small boats or simply enjoying the lakeside ambiance. It's important to note that no glass is allowed at beach sites, a rule in place to ensure safety for all visitors.

For those with off-highway vehicles (OHVs), West Beach Campground offers a unique advantage. Yuba State Park allows ATV/OHV access from the campground to nearby trails. This means visitors can ride their OHVs directly to and from designated riding areas, though recreational riding within the camping areas themselves is strictly prohibited, with a maximum speed of 15 MPH. This feature makes West Beach an attractive option for adventurers who wish to combine their camping trip with motorized trail exploration, adding another dimension to the "camping near me" search for many outdoor enthusiasts.

In terms of services and amenities, while West Beach is categorized as primitive camping, it does provide some essential conveniences. As part of Yuba State Park, visitors have access to shared resources and regulations. While West Beach itself primarily offers picnic tables, fire rings, and restrooms, the broader state park might offer more developed amenities elsewhere, such as modern restrooms with hot showers and dump stations at areas like Oasis or Painted Rocks, though it's important to confirm which specific amenities are available directly at West Beach. Drinking water is generally available within the park, but campers at West Beach may need to confirm the nearest access point. Pets are welcome at the campground, provided they are kept on a leash, adhering to standard park policies, which is a significant plus for pet owners searching for "camping near me" options.

Regarding promotional information and booking, West Beach Campground typically operates on a first-come, first-served basis for its primitive sites, though it's always advisable to check current conditions and reservation possibilities through the Utah State Parks website or by calling the park directly. The fee structure for West Beach Campground is generally per vehicle per night, with specific rates for primitive camping at the beach areas. It's crucial for visitors to be aware that gates at the campgrounds are typically closed from 10 p.m. to 7 a.m., which means no entry or exit during those hours. Also, campers are usually required to bring their own firewood. Ice is often available at the park headquarters during summer months.
